Jack Attridge is a 13th-generation<br />
Marblehead resident, principal of<br />
the Attridge Group at William Raveis<br />
Real Estate, and the founder of All<br />
Marblehead, a social media initiative<br />
created as a place for people who are<br />
interested in the town of Marblehead to<br />
learn about local events and discuss town<br />
topics in a positive and constructive way.<br />
The platforms also promote Attridge's<br />
real estate business.<br />
In 2009, Attridge launched the All<br />
Marblehead Facebook page as a place to<br />
"put my real estate going forward and to<br />
share a lot of community information.<br />
"It started organically and just grew,"<br />
Attridge said. "The platform is there<br />
for everyone to use and we decided to<br />
leverage it to connect the community.<br />
Really the mission, outside of the 5<br />
percent that supports my business, is to<br />
support Marblehead, Marblehead people,<br />
Marblehead businesses and nonprofits."<br />
The All Marblehead Facebook<br />
page has more than 17,000 followers,<br />
while Instagram has about 8,600.<br />
Both platforms feature anything and<br />
everything happening or about to happen<br />
in Marblehead as well as thousands of<br />
some of the most beautiful photos you<br />
will ever see.<br />
From amazing sunsets to Christmas<br />
trees in dinghies in Marblehead Harbor<br />
to historical sites and places, the photos<br />
bring out Marblehead's unique charm<br />
